I'm Australian and have used Alpha-H in the past. I think it's a good line and there are still some products of theirs I want to try, mainly the masks.
These are the products I have tried (I have normal skin):
Liquid Gold (glycolic treatment) was good but I think it ended up being too drying on my skin. My mum liked it though, she went through a couple of bottles before moving onto something new (she has my problem - product junkie!).
Microcleanse: this stuff is great. It cleanses really well and it's not too drying. I only had a sample tube.
10% Balancing Moisturiser: only had a sample of this but from memory it was ok. It mustn't have impressed me that much otherwise I'd have bought a full-sized bottle.
Balancing Cleanser: this was really quite nice but I prefer a foaming cleanser (this is more a cream cleanser).
I've tried the eye creams and they didn't impress me too much, but I'm not a big eye cream person.
